How they compare
Austria currently reports 1.67 GPIA against 1.62 GPIA in Italy, a difference of 0.05 GPIA.
Across all 11 years both countries report, Austria has been ahead every year.
Austria ranks 15th and Italy ranks 18th of 49 countries.
Austria has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
